Bad Credit Used Car Loan - What to Watch Out For

Used car loans are usually for smaller principal amounts than new car loans, so, if you have bad credit, you may be better off financing a used car purchase. However, financing a used car has several pitfalls -- you won’t want to continue making payments on a car that doesn't work anymore. Car Costs More Than it's Worth

If the car you're buying is worth less than the amount of money you're trying to borrow, you're a lot less likely to get approved for your loan. For one, it represents a much higher risk to your lender; if you can't repay the loan, they may not get back all of the money they lent you. Secondly, you'll be upside-down in your loan. This can damage your credit even more than missing payments.

Car Has No Warranty

If the car you're buying is used, then it's likely that it will have some mechanical wear. If you can't afford to repair these things when they go out, you'll want to get a used car with a warranty. If the dealership you're purchasing it from does not offer warranties, take the car to a mechanic before buying it. If the dealership is not a predatory lender, they should have no problem with you taking the car to an outside mechanic in order for an opinion on the car’s condition. If they refuse to allow you to do so, they’re probably not a reputable company.

Buy-Here-Pay-Here Car Lots

Buy-here-pay-here car lots generally charge high interest rates, have poor cars, and don't report to the credit bureaus. For a person trying to repair their credit, this is the worst deal you could agree to. you're much better off trying to secure a loan through a bank. While banks generally charge higher interest rates on used cars than on new cars, their rates are still lower than those of buy-here-pay-here car lot loans. you're best bet is to avoid these car lots entirely.
